Flat World Knowledge

There has been a coup in the assault against one of the longest standing scams going. Flat World Knowledge is a social network driven sight that is offering customizable university/college textbooks on line for free. Typically an outrageous expense for the already burdened, Flat World Knowledge is trying to make an open source movement.

It may work, too. They've got an original and complete concept. Students don't only get the books as published, they can alter and edit as well. Medium is also customizable. There are some audio, online and print options.
